Reissued in the year of Miep Gies' 100th birthday, this international bestseller includes a brand-new afterword by the author.
For the millions moved by Anne Frank: The Diary of a Young Girl, here is Miep Gies''s own astonishing story. For more than two years, Miep and her husband helped hide the Franks from the Nazis. Like thousands of unsung heroes of the Holocaust, they risked their lives every day to bring food, news, and emotional support to its victims.
From her remarkable childhood as a World War I refugee to the moment she places a small, red-orange-checkered diary -- Anne''s legacy -- into Otto Frank''s hands, Miep Gies remembers her days with simple honesty and shattering clarity. Each page rings with courage and heartbreaking beauty.
